How UV Printing Supports ADA-Compliant Braille Signage Compliance

Traditional Braille sign fabrication can be complex, involving multiple steps and significant labor. UV printing simplifies the process by using precision ink layering to print raised Braille dots and tactile characters directly onto the substrate. This single-step method reduces production time, lowers labor costs, and improves overall efficiency.

Specifications
ADA Requirement

Braille Type

Grade 2 Braille

Braille Dot Shape

Rounded, domed dots

Dot Height

.025 to .037 inches (0.6 mm to 0.9 mm) 

Dot Base Diameter

.059 to .063 inches (1.5 mm to 1.6 mm)

Inter-dot Spacing

Horizontal: 0.090 inches (2.3 mm); Vertical: 0.241 inches (6.1 mm)

Tactile Letter Height

5/8 inch to 2 inches (16 mm to 50 mm)

Finish

Non-glare

Contrast

Characters must contrast with background (light-on-dark or dark-on-light)

Comparing UV Printing vs. Traditional Braille Fabrication

Method
Fabrication Process
Dry Time
Components
Setup Cost
Durability
Production Cost

UV-LED (MUTOH XPJ-661UF)

Digital printing

None

Substrate & Ink

No added cost

High

Low

Raster

Drilling, inserting beads, painting

In some cases

Substrate, Raster beads, Ink/Paint

Medium

High

Medium

Photopolymer

Film generation, multiple steps

In some cases

Substrate, Film, Topcoat, Pain

High

Medium

High

(Source: Braille Fabrication Comparison, Mutoh)
The UV-LED method significantly simplifies the process while maintaining ADA compliance and producing superior tactile quality.
